🌼 What Is AI-Powered Feedback?
Let’s start with a calm, clear explanation. AI-powered feedback simply means tools or systems that analyze student work — essays, answers, tasks, even coding assignments — and give suggestions, corrections, or guidance based on patterns learned from huge amounts of data.
The system might point out grammar mistakes, highlight unclear arguments, suggest improvements in structure, or flag conceptual misunderstandings. It can even give supportive explanations about why something is incorrect or how to improve it. 💬✨
AI feedback is fast. Like… very fast. It can review dozens of assignments in seconds. For teachers with large classes, this feels like having an assistant who never gets tired 🥰.
But the key is balance — AI gives support, not final judgment. Teachers still guide with wisdom, empathy, and intuition. Students still grow through effort, curiosity, and reflection. AI just helps illuminate the path.

🌻 How Teachers Can Use AI Feedback Effectively
Let’s talk about the heart of this article — how AI can actually be used well in real classrooms, whether in junior high, high school, vocational schools, or even adult learning environments.
This isn’t about fancy theories. This is practical, grounded, real-world application that teachers can start using today.
1. Use AI as a Draft Reviewer, Not a Final Grader
One of the best ways to use AI is as a draft checker. Students submit work → AI gives instant feedback → students revise → teacher reads the improved version.
This encourages:
• deeper thinking
• higher quality submissions
• better writing and reasoning habits
Teachers become mentors instead of being drowned in basic correction work.
2. Teach Students to Read Feedback Critically
Students need to treat AI suggestions like gentle hints, not absolute truth.
This builds:
🌼 critical thinking
🌼 independence
🌼 deeper understanding
A teacher can guide them with questions like:
“What do you think about the suggestion? Does it strengthen your idea?”
3. Use AI to Identify Class-Wide Learning Gaps
AI tools can quickly scan dozens of responses and say:
“Hey, half the class struggled with fractions”
or
“Many students don’t understand photosynthesis clearly.”
Teachers can then plan targeted lessons, mini-workshops, or fun review games to fix those gaps. 🎮✨
4. Personalize Feedback for Different Skill Levels
A vocational school student studying automotive engineering might need step-by-step guidance.
A high-performing academic student might need deeper critical challenges.
A shy student might need encouraging, gentle feedback.
AI helps teachers create differentiated support efficiently and consistently.
5. Use AI for Non-Graded Practice Activities
Students sometimes fear making mistakes. AI practice tools remove that fear because the feedback is private, instant, and safe.
This is perfect for:
• language learning
• essays
• math step-by-step reasoning
• programming tasks
• science explanations
Quiet students especially benefit — they get a chance to practice at their own pace, without pressure 🥺💛.
6. Let AI Handle the “Mechanical” Corrections
Teachers don’t need to spend 10 minutes correcting comma usage or repeated phrases in every essay. AI can handle the technical side.
Teachers can then focus on creativity, emotion, argument quality, and growth mindset.
This leads to more meaningful teacher–student conversations.

🌷 Challenges Teachers Should Keep in Mind
Of course, every good thing comes with responsibilities. Using AI feedback wisely means being aware of possible limitations.
• AI can misunderstand context
• AI may give overly generic advice
• AI might struggle with creative or unusual answers
• AI doesn't understand emotion the way humans do
• Students might over-rely on it
That’s why teachers remain the “captains of the ship” 🚢💕. AI is useful, but not infallible. Teachers guide how it’s used and make sure the learning stays authentic and meaningful.
